RIJWAN DESAI Email: *****.******@*****.***
Mobile: +91-973*******
DOB: 19-Mar-1987
SkypeID: desai.rijwan
Specific Expertise
H1B VISA holder
Microsoft Certified Solution Developer (MCSD) with 6.8 years of experience in analysis, design and development of web-based and n-tier application in Microsoft Visual Studio .Net using C#, ASP.NET, ADO.NET,WCF,SQL Server, SharePoint Designer 2013.
Hands-On ecperience on Jenkins, artifactory,powershell DSC
Hands-on experience on Data Adapter, Dataset, Data reader as a part of ADO.NET.
Hands on experience in MVC4, Razor engine, Powershell,Jenkins.
SQL Server Database design, Database maintenance, developing T-SQL queries, stored procedures, Cursor and triggers using SQL Server 2005, 2008.
Hands-on experience in Web Services, WCF Services, CSS, HTML, AJAX and JavaScript
Design and Develop custom SharePoint 2013 applications using SharePoint Designer.
Design and Develop custom C# SharePoint 2013 Web Parts.
A good learner an excellent team player.
Computer System Experience
Microsoft Technologies : ASP.NET, C#.NET, ADO.NET, WCF, MVC 4
Language : C#, T-SQL, LINQ
Scripts : Java Script, JQuery, Ajax,Powershell,DSC,CURL,Batch Command
Concepts : DBMS, OOPs, Software Engineering
Operating System : Windows 7, Windows XP
RDBMS : SQL-Server 05/08
Web server : IIS
Web tools : HTML, Java Script, JQuery, CSS
Framework : .Net Framework 3.5/4.0/4.5
Service : WCF, Web Services
Build Tool : Jenkins
Repository : JFrog Artifactory
Awards
Star Award for remarkable work in Elliemae, Q3-2015 by Xoriant
Star Award for remarkable work in DevOps, Q3-2016 by Xoriant
Titans Team award for project Performance Testing Tool, Q1-2016 by Xoriant
Certifications
Microsoft Certified Solutions Developer – Web Applications
Microsoft Certified Professional – Developing Asp.Net MVC 4 Web Applications
Microsoft Specialist – Programming in HTML5 with JavaScript and CSS3
MCTS: Web Applications Development with Microsoft .NET Framework 4
MongoDB certification By University.MongoDB.com
Scrum Fundamentals Certified by SCRUM Study.
Professional Experience:
JUN 15 – Present Xoriant Solution Pvt. Ltd. Software Engineer
Project I CI-CD Automation
Description Continuous Integration (CI) is a development practice that requires developers to integrate code into a shared repository several times a day. Each check-in is then verified by an automated build, allowing teams to detect problems early.
Continuous Delivery can help large organizations become as lean, agile and innovative as startups. Through reliable, low-risk releases. Test, support, development and operations work together as one delivery team to automate and streamline the build, test and release process.
Contribution
Automated process for Continuous Integration and Continuous Deployment pipelines
Installation and configuration for Jenkins server and its nodes
Pull code from different source control manger (SCM) tools TFS, GIT and subversion
Build source code using build tools like MS Build and Maven
Run test cases using testing tools like MS Test and Selenium
Configure deployment servers using PowerShell and Windows DSC
Develop delivery pipelines for Dev, QA, INT, Stage and Prod deployments serves using Jenkins
Lead a team and share daily, weekly progress report for high visibility to Client and Offshore Management
Environment TFS, GIT, MS Build, Maven, MS Test, Selenium, Jenkins, Jfrog Artifactory, PowerShell, Windows DSC, CURL
Project II Production Traffic Replay Framework
Description This project contain three modules such as Replay Framework,Scrub Util, Perf-UI.
Replay Framework - Replay Framework is a standalone utility. It does the processing to replay logs.
Scrub Util - Scrubbing utility has three sections Log File scrubbing, Loan File scrubbing and Database scrubbing
Perf UI – It is web based application to configure replay framework.
Contribution Involved in Analysis, Design and Implementation for the application. Writing unit and integration test cases using N-Substitute framework.
Environment MVC, C#, SQL Server, JavaScript, SOAP UI
Project III Elliemae
Description Third Party Originator (TPO). This system provides the means of originating the mortgage loans to the third party originators of mortgage lenders. This system integrates with various third party systems and is a web based version which provides access to the key functionalities of the core system: Encompass. Users can create the loan applications, order various services, find the product and pricing, and request the underwriting and credit report using the TPO system. Encompass Solution. Overview: This system provides end to end solution for mortgage banking, right from capturing loan application till disbursement of funds. This system also provides functionality of pooling the loans for secondary market and Mortgage-backed securities (MBS) trading.
Contribution Involved in Analysis, Design and Implementation for the application. Developing WCF services from end to end. Writing unit and integration test cases using N-Substitute framework.
Environment WCF, MongoDB, SQL Server, JavaScript, Angularjs, SOAP UI
April 13 – May 15 YASH Technologies Pvt. Ltd. Sr. Software Engineer
Project I S & B Company
Description S&B is a global diversified minerals and materials group, providing industrial solutions based on natural resources, to a wide range of markets, such as foundry, construction, metallurgy and various specialty niche sectors. This project is about branding the intranet site of S&B Company to their end users to collaborate all the divisions and different BU’s- foundry, construction, metallurgy and more at single channel within the organization.
Contribution Involved in Analysis, Design and Implementation for the application. Created custom master pages & Site pages using SharePoint designer. Create Custom Web parts Using MVC4 & C#. Get data from various lists using JQuery and display on pages. Implement survey for the site. Involved in Unit Testing for concern module.
Environment HTML, JQuery, CSS, SharePoint designer 2013, MVC4,C#, Visual Studio 2012
Project II E - Learning
Description E-Learning is a product that has been conceptualized to impart learning to students either within Classroom or over Internet for students. This method allows the flexibility to students to go through the Course designed by their tutors and take assessment based on their schedule. This concept also allows flexibility in their schedule to manage and complete their scheduled assessments of their term course.
Contribution Involved in Analysis, Design and Implementation for the application. Involved in Unit Testing for concern module
Environment MVC4, JQuery, C#, Visual Studio 2012, EF4, LINQ
Oct 11 - March 13 Gurujiworld Technologies Pvt. Ltd. Software Engineer
Project I GEMS SaaS School ERP product
Description The project Gems SaaS (Software as a service) is the school ERP we are developing as a service based application where multiple school can use our application and manage their schools it contains the module like online admission process,fees management, student management, Voucher, Library, etc.
Contribution Responsible creating database tables with database normalization and involved in friendly database design. Used N-tier architecture for presentation layer, the Business and Data Access Layers and were coded using C#. Written stored procedure, triggers, cursor using in SQL Server. Created WCF service for Data Roll Up process. Used AJAX to minimize server round trip and enhance user experience. Extensive use of MS Chart control for different type of charts. Deployment of project on the Live Server.
Environment ASP.NET, C#.NET, SQL Server 2008, Ajax, JQuery, Linq, WCF.
Education MCA (Masters in Computer Application)
BCA (Bachelors in Computer Application)